Output 6239663a6695a033116fc89fed959e5085bb38771612e4e9a1d196e37eb63c87:1

value
24918643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5db8330a87ac803fcddcf595f0f7c4291abb358 OP_EQUAL
address
3KjC1Kx64bdB5TWng4q7EFnudyaKUUYSV3
transaction
6239663a6695a033116fc89fed959e5085bb38771612e4e9a1d196e37eb63c87
spent
true